How To Write Resume For Historic Sites Registrar
- Highlight your expertise in historic preservation laws and regulations.
- Quantify your accomplishments to demonstrate the impact of your work.
- Showcase your ability to collaborate with diverse stakeholders, including property owners, architects, and community groups.
- Emphasize your passion for preserving our cultural heritage and your commitment to protecting historic sites for future generations.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’s) For Historic Sites Registrar
What is the primary role of a Historic Sites Registrar?
A Historic Sites Registrar is responsible for identifying, documenting, and preserving significant historic sites. This includes conducting research, administering grant programs, developing preservation plans, and negotiating easements and deed restrictions to protect historic properties.
What are the key skills required for this role?
Strong knowledge of historic preservation principles, expertise in architectural history and cultural resource management, proficiency in GIS mapping and data analysis, and exc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
What is the job outlook for Historic Sites Registrars?
The job outlook is expected to grow faster than average, as there is an increasing demand for professionals to identify, preserve, and protect historic sites.
What are the career advancement opportunities?
With experience, Historic Sites Registrars can advance to leadership roles in historic preservation organizations, government agencies, or non-profit organizations.
What is the salary range for this position?
The salary range for Historic Sites Registrars can vary depending on experience, location, and employer. According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ual salary for Archivists, Curators, and Museum Workers was $56,790 in May 2021.
What are the educational requirements?
A Master’s Degree in Historic Preservation or a related field is typically required for this role.
Where can I find job openings for Historic Sites Registrars?
Job openings can be found on job boards specializing in history, preservation, and cultural heritage, as well as on the websites of historic preservation organizations and government agencies.
